Thorns and Blooms
Thorns and Blooms Plot:
Su Wanqing was once the secret wife of Gu Siyan, CEO of Gu's Group. Framed by her stepsister Su Xiaorou, she was accused of infidelity by her mother-in-law, losing her unborn child and being kicked out with nothing. Three years later, she returns as world-renowned designer "Luna", determined to get justice. Her design stolen? She exposes Su Xiaorou's plagiarism. Mother-in-law humiliates her? She pulls out Gu's cooperation contract to shut her up. Gu Siyan, who never moved on, helps uncover the truth while fighting to win her back. When hatred and love collide, can they overcome thorns to regain their blooms?
